What companies run services between Kevelaer, Germany and Heidelberg, Germany?

You can take a train from Kevelaer Bahnhof to Heidelberg, Hauptbahnhof via Düsseldorf Hbf and Mannheim, Hauptbahnhof in around 3h 46m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Kevelaer Bahnhof to Heidelberg Pre Waypoint via Nijmegen Centraal Station in around 7h 42m.
